Geopolitical Instability Drives Focus on Greenland’s Energy Potential

Recent geopolitical instability and disruptions at key global chokepoints like the Strait of Hormuz have exposed vulnerabilities in energy supply chains, according to a NetworkNewsWire editorial. This has intensified efforts among U.S. and European policymakers to diversify energy sources and strengthen domestic production capabilities.

The editorial positions Greenland Energy’s exploration activities in Greenland’s Jameson Land Basin within this broader strategic push toward long-term energy security. The basin is estimated to contain up to 13 billion barrels of oil potential, representing a significant underexplored resource at a time when major discoveries have become increasingly rare worldwide.

Greenland Energy has secured drilling capacity and is planning key wells to advance development of the basin’s resources while maintaining financial flexibility. The company’s progress comes as frontier exploration in politically stable regions like Greenland attracts growing interest from both investors and industry participants seeking alternatives to traditional production areas.

The editorial highlights Greenland Energy alongside other major industry players pursuing similar frontier exploration projects, reflecting a broader industry shift toward developing new energy supplies in stable jurisdictions. This trend responds to both continued global energy demand and escalating geopolitical risks that threaten traditional supply routes.

As global energy markets face ongoing uncertainty, developments in regions like Greenland’s Jameson Land Basin could play an increasingly important role in diversifying energy sources and reducing dependence on volatile supply corridors.
